The surname Kaltenborn is of German origin. It is a toponymic surname, meaning that it is derived from a place name. In this case, Kaltenborn likely originated from a town or village in Germany. The prefix "Kalt" means cold in German, indicating that the original location may have been a cold or chilly place. The suffix "born" is a common element in German place names, usually referring to a stream or a small river.
The surname Kaltenborn has a long history in Germany. It first appears in historical records in the 13th century, particularly in the region of Rhineland. The earliest known bearers of the surname were likely residents of the town of Kaltenborn or had some connection to the area. Over time, the surname spread to other parts of Germany and eventually to other countries.
The surname Kaltenborn also has a presence in the United States. German immigrants brought the surname with them when they settled in the New World. The first recorded instances of the surname in the US date back to the 18th century, with immigrants arriving from Germany and establishing their families in American soil. Today, there are approximately 155 individuals with the surname Kaltenborn in the US, according to available data.
In addition to Germany and the US, the surname Kaltenborn can also be found in other countries around the world. Norway is one such country where the surname has a small presence, with around 65 individuals bearing the name. Other countries with a smaller number of individuals with the surname Kaltenborn include Canada, Finland, Argentina, England, Sweden, Bulgaria, Switzerland, Ireland, and Kazakhstan.
As with many surnames, variations of the surname Kaltenborn exist due to differences in spelling and pronunciation over time. Some common variations of the surname include Kaltenberg, Kaltenbrun, and Kaltenbourn. Despite these variations, the core meaning and origin of the surname remain the same.
Although the surname Kaltenborn is not as well-known as some other surnames, there have been notable individuals with the name throughout history. One such individual was Hans Kaltenborn, a German-American journalist and radio commentator known for his coverage of World War II. His radio broadcasts were influential in shaping public opinion during the war.
